Senior System Power Optimization Software Engineer

2 days ago


Hsinchu County, Taiwan MediaTek Full time $104,000 - $130,878 per year

Job Description
Responsible for SoC/system-level performance and power analysis and optimization.

Collaborate with hardware, firmware, software, and architecture teams to drive performance and power improvement initiatives.

Conduct in-depth analysis of system bottlenecks and propose effective optimization solutions.

Participate in the development and tuning of technologies such as DVFS, low-power design, and system resource management.

Optimize Windows PPM (Processor Power Management) settings for Windows on platforms to enhance system performance and power efficiency.

Analyze and tune Windows Power Management settings to ensure optimal performance and minimal power consumption across various usage scenarios.

Prepare technical reports and documentation, and provide technical support to internal teams and customers.

Requirement
Master's degree or above in Electrical Engineering, Electronic Engineering, Computer Engineering, or related fields.

Over 5 years of experience in SoC/system performance and power optimization.

Proficient in SoC architecture (ARM/x86) and operating systems (Android/Linux/Windows).

Skilled in performance and power analysis tools (such as perf, trace, power profiler, power modeling).

Experience with DVFS, low-power design, and system resource management.

Capable of conducting in-depth analysis of system bottlenecks and proposing optimization solutions.

Strong cross-functional communication and coordination skills; able to work independently or as part of a team to complete projects.

Excellent English communication skills for collaboration with global teams.

Preferred Qualifications
Experience in CPU/GPU/SoC product development.

Familiarity with WoA (Windows on ARM) platform architecture and experience in optimizing Windows PPM (Processor Power Management) settings.

In-depth understanding of Windows Power Management software architecture, including power policy, power states, driver interactions, and OS power frameworks.

Experience in developing or tuning Windows power management drivers (such as ACPI, PEP, power framework).

Proficient in configuring Windows power policies and adjusting performance/power profiles.

Experience in mobile, IoT, or automotive product development.

Experience in customer technical support or international collaboration.



  • Hsinchu County,, Taiwan MediaTek Full time NT$1,800,000 - NT$2,500,000 per year

    Job DescriptionCreate wearable use cases for the glasses ecosystem by identifying technical requirements, designing data paths, and estimating performance.Design and implement software stack/architecture, including detailed implementation plans.Identify AR technologies and propose software/hardware solutions to optimize power consumption and...


  • Hsinchu,, Taiwan MediaTek Full time $90,000 - $120,000 per year

    Job DescriptionAI Processor System Software Engineer is responsible for MediaTek AI Processor system software development. Major responsibilities are,Develop and optimize runtime, Linux kernel drivers, and firmware of AI processors to maximize system performance.Design NPUSYS architecture and implement SW in the early-development stage.RequirementStrong...


  • Hsinchu County,, Taiwan MediaTek Full time $90,000 - $120,000 per year

    Job DescriptionWe are seeking a Senior Quality Verification Engineer for our Computing product line.Key Responsibilities1、Develop and implement test plans and test cases based on product design and customer requirements to ensure that product quality standards are met.2、Directly interface with notebook brand customers; participate in customer audits,...


  • Hsinchu County,, Taiwan MediaTek Full time NT$900,000 - NT$1,200,000 per year

    Job DescriptionPrimary person in charge for software issues related to the Android platform.Analyze, clarify, and resolve or escalate Android framework related issues reported by customers.Conduct root cause analysis and provide immediate solutions or alternatives.Collaborate with internal engineering teams to ensure effective resolution of issues.Perform...


  • Hsinchu County,, Taiwan MediaTek Full time $104,000 - $130,878 per year

    Job DescriptionSoC FPGA/ASIC Verification and driver developmentSoC SDK platform development on Windows and UEFI platformWindows system analysis and performance improvement on ARM platformsRequirementAt least 4 years of experience with embedded system software development is preferredExperience developing low-level, driver, or kernel components for modern...


  • Hsinchu County,, Taiwan Roku Full time $70,000 - $120,000 per year

    Teamwork makes the stream work.Roku is changing how the world watches TVRoku is the #1 TV streaming platform in the U.S., Canada, and Mexico, and we've set our sights on powering every television in the world. Roku pioneered streaming to the TV. Our mission is to be the TV streaming platform that connects the entire TV ecosystem. We connect consumers to the...


  • Hsinchu,, Taiwan MediaTek Full time NT$600,000 - NT$1,200,000 per year

    Job DescriptionWrite or port device driversWrite hardware module testing programPerform hardware module pre- and post-silicon validationoptimize system low power performance and analyze system issuesRequirementFamiliar with embedded Linux software developmentFamiliar with CPU(ARM like) architecture and RTOSStrong programming skills in CKnowledge and...


  • Hsinchu,, Taiwan MediaTek Full time $104,000 - $130,878 per year

    Job DescriptionCPU Embedded Software EngineerThe ideal candidate will be responsible for developing and maintaining the embedded software stack for CPU/MCU subsystem.This role requires a deep understanding of CPU architecture, low-level system software development, and MCU peripherals.Design, develop, and optimize the software stack for MCUs, including...


  • Hsinchu,, Taiwan MediaTek Full time $104,000 - $130,878 per year

    Job DescriptionAnalyze and optimize system architecture strategies to enhance performance in gaming scenarios and improve user experience.Develop system models for performance and power consumption, clarify issues through simulating hardware-software interactions, and identify potential technical solutions.Provide recommendations and direction to the...


  • Hsinchu,, Taiwan MediaTek Full time $90,000 - $120,000 per year

    Job DescriptionThe AI Processor System Software Engineer will be responsible for the development and optimization of system software and firmware for MediaTek AI processors. Key responsibilities include:Developing and optimizing drivers for AI processors to enhance system performance.Conducting hardware IP device validation tests to verify AI engine...